Kaydet (Commit) cb19a99b authored tarafından Caolán McNamara's avatar Caolán McNamara

coverity#1251173 Dereference before null check

Change-Id: I3e5a70289785f905350c895b6c869eaebe360bf8
üst a05da74d
......@@ -667,17 +667,17 @@ void DrawViewShell::FuDeleteSelectedObjects()
bConsumed = true;
}
if (!bConsumed)
if (!bConsumed && mpDrawView)
{
::vcl::KeyCode aKCode(KEY_DELETE);
KeyEvent aKEvt( 0, aKCode);
bConsumed = mpDrawView->getSmartTags().KeyInput( aKEvt );
if( !bConsumed && HasCurrentFunction() )
if (!bConsumed && HasCurrentFunction())
bConsumed = GetCurrentFunction()->KeyInput(aKEvt);
if( !bConsumed && mpDrawView )
if (!bConsumed)
mpDrawView->DeleteMarked();
}
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ment